What Is University of Maryland?
The University of Maryland College Park is the flagship institution of the University System of Maryland (USM) which is comprised of 11 campuses, about 70 centers and institutes, and three other research and public service institutes. Each institution has its own programs and expertise. Unlike other state systems, USM consists of multiple schools rather than one school with multiple campuses.
